VENU Plans $80 Million Sale-Leaseback Financing for Parking Garage Asset at Sunset Amphitheater in McKinney, Texas
June 15, 2026 7:00 AM EDTCompany seeks to advance national expansion through innovative financing model; Founder personally invested in Companys first sale-leaseback transaction as part of an approximately $250 million capital strategy
DALLAS--(BUSINESS WIRE)-- Venu Holding Corporation ("VENU" or the "Company") (NYSE American: VENU), owner, operator, and developer of premium live entertainment destinations, today announced that... More
